![]() This function returns the total number of records in the COMPANY table. The following example illustrates creating and calling a standalone function. For backward compatibility, the name can be enclosed by single quotes. Here, we use this option for PostgreSQL, it Can be SQL, C, internal, or the name of a user-defined procedural language. Postgresql Update inside For Loop-postgresql. In this article, we will learn what is looping, why it is required, and the various types of looping statements, and how we can use for loop in PostgreSQL functions to achieve our intention or get our work done. Plpgsql is the name of the language that the function is implemented in.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ap. Introduction to PostgreSQL For Loop In the PostgreSQL database, we can use many conditional and looping statements. This error indicates that a pod failed to. The AS keyword is used for creating a standalone function. CrashLoopBackOff is a common error that you may have encountered when running your first containers on Kubernetes. The return_datatype can be a base, composite, or domain type, or can reference the type of a table column.įunction-body contains the executable part. The cursor FOR loop opens a previously declared cursor, fetches all rows in the cursor result set, and then closes the cursor. RETURN clause specifies that data type you are going to return from the function. The function must contain a return statement. option allows modifying an existing function. RETURNS return_datatype AS $variable_name$įunction-name specifies the name of the function. The basic syntax to create a function is as follows −ĬREATE FUNCTION function_name (arguments) The run remains open throughout the with statement, and is automatically closed. This will do though (but someone can probably make it cleaner) INSERT INTO articles WITH RECURSIVE i AS ( SELECT 1 x UNION ALL SELECT x + 1 FROM i WHERE x < 10000000 ) SELECT x FROM i Share. ![]() ![]() It is different from FOR IN interval and it is different from PL/SQL FOR IN SELECT. Functions allow database reuse as other applications can interact directly with your stored procedures instead of a middle-tier or duplicating code.įunctions can be created in a language of your choice like SQL, PL/pgSQL, C, Python, etc. MLflow supports the dialects mysql, mssql, sqlite, and postgresql. Afaik, you cant write a loop directly as SQL, youd have to create a stored procedure to do it. postgresql plpgsql Share Improve this question Follow asked at 17:19 Fabien Snauwaert 4,945 5 52 69 Unfortunately, due technical reasons for FOR IN SELECT statement, iterator should be declared. PostgreSQL functions, also known as Stored Procedures, allow you to carry out operations that would normally take several queries and round trips in a single function within the database. from typing import List from sqlalchemy import Column, Integer, String from import ARRAY from. ![]()
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|